Hmmmm, sounds like you have been changing tubes too often, leaving it on too long, warming it up too long, need a tube tester to have confidence in your tubes, perhaps lost confidence in the preamp’s innards ........ perhaps have a pro overhaul it.

A set of tubes should last thousands of hours, and an inexpensive tube tester keeps you from guessing if you suspect something.

IF you want a unit without remote and/or balance, you can use a Chase Remote Line Controller RLC-1: either 4 sources directly to it, or sources to preamp, use tape or processor loop for the RLC-1. 

You MUST have the remote, no controls are on the unit. Here’s a new one

Dead quiet,There is simply no evidence of it’s existence except you get wonderful remote power, volume, balance, ....

Oh yeah, it has automatic and progressive fletcher munson bass boost for very low level listening,

I've got 3 of them in use and a spare.

Office used just for remote power, Luxman has remote volume, I take a short hike to change inputs, leave it's balance where I set it.

Garage/Shop, via Yamaha Receiver's Processor Loop for remote volume and importantly, mute.

Main, between tube preamp and tube integrated amp for remote system power, remote volume, remote balance, mute: lets me use my beloved vintage McIntosh mx110z tube preamp with no remote features.
